Transaction 21cfbd08a08cfef308c7e7579e3ecde9c1fd52204ccd0a0e43d5887adc24df52

1 Input
2 Outputs
  • 21cfbd08a08cfef308c7e7579e3ecde9c1fd52204ccd0a0e43d5887adc24df52:0
  • value  1834077312
    address  13kDdGvwvTURHNTexyyKAfQKBbyxcf5XKk
  • 21cfbd08a08cfef308c7e7579e3ecde9c1fd52204ccd0a0e43d5887adc24df52:1
  • value  1405276985
    address  1HcUigSiZcRA1Km7FH8UyFX7s6xADERC8R